Strategies for Finding a Long-Term Partner
For a 23-year-old male from Texas looking for long-term commitment, employing effective strategies is crucial. It’s not just about being in the right place at the right time; it’s about actively positioning yourself to meet compatible individuals and nurturing those connections. One of the most effective approaches is to define what 'long-term' means to you. This involves introspection about your values, future goals, and the kind of partner who would complement your life. Are you looking for someone to share adventures with, build a family with, or simply grow alongside? Once you have a clearer picture, you can start to focus your efforts. Dating apps, while sometimes seen as superficial, can be powerful tools if used wisely. Optimize your profile to reflect your personality and your desire for a serious relationship. Be honest in your bio and choose photos that showcase your genuine self. Engage in conversations that go beyond small talk, asking thoughtful questions and sharing your own insights. However, don't rely solely on apps. Expand your social circle through hobbies and interests. Join a recreational sports league, a book club, a hiking group, or volunteer for a cause you care about. These activities naturally connect you with people who share your passions, creating a foundation for deeper connections. For a 23-year-old exploring his options, these shared interests often lead to more natural and comfortable interactions, making the prospect of a long-term relationship feel less daunting. Attend social events and be open to meeting new people. Go to gatherings hosted by friends, community events, or even professional networking functions. The key is to be approachable and willing to strike up conversations. Remember, the goal is to build genuine connections, not just to find 'the one' immediately. Focus on building friendships first. Sometimes, the strongest long-term relationships evolve from friendships. Allowing a connection to develop organically can reveal true compatibility that might be missed in the initial stages of romantic pursuit. For a 23-year-old male in Texas, embracing these multifaceted strategies will significantly increase your chances of finding a meaningful, long-term partner who aligns with your vision for the future.

Building a Future Together: What Matters Most
As a 23-year-old male from Texas looking for long-term commitment, thinking about what truly matters in building a future together is essential. It's easy to get caught up in the excitement of a new relationship, but long-term success hinges on deeper compatibility and shared vision. Communication stands at the forefront. Open, honest, and respectful dialogue is the bedrock of any strong partnership. This means being able to express your needs, listen actively to your partner's concerns, and navigate disagreements constructively. As you grow older, your communication skills will need to evolve, and finding a partner who prioritizes this will be invaluable. Shared values and life goals are also critical. While you don't need to agree on everything, having a similar outlook on fundamental aspects of life—such as family, career ambitions, financial management, and personal growth—creates a harmonious path forward. For a 23-year-old, these might still be developing, but understanding your core values now will help you identify potential partners whose principles align with yours. Mutual respect and support are non-negotiable. A long-term partner should be your biggest cheerleader, supporting your dreams and ambitions, and vice versa. This also involves respecting each other's individuality, boundaries, and personal space. Resilience and adaptability are key, especially as life inevitably throws challenges your way. The ability to face adversity together, to learn from setbacks, and to grow as a couple is a hallmark of enduring relationships. For a 23-year-old male in Texas, this might mean navigating career changes, family responsibilities, or unexpected life events. Having a partner who can weather these storms with you makes all the difference. Ultimately, building a long-term future is about creating a partnership where both individuals feel seen, heard, valued, and loved. It's a continuous process of growth, compromise, and shared experiences. By focusing on these core elements, you'll be well on your way to finding a long-term partner who is not just a companion, but a true teammate in life's grand adventure.
